How to Withdraw Money from a HSA Card?

Withdrawing money from a Health Savings Account (HSA) card is a convenient way to access your funds for eligible medical expenses. Here's how you can do it:

  1. Use your HSA debit card at healthcare providers: Most HSA providers issue a debit card that you can use to pay for eligible medical expenses directly at the point of purchase.
  2. Pay out-of-pocket and reimburse yourself: If you don't have your HSA card with you, you can pay for the medical expense out-of-pocket and later reimburse yourself from your HSA account.
  3. Transfer funds to your bank account: Some HSA providers allow you to transfer money from your HSA account to your linked bank account. This way, you can access the funds easily for non-medical expenses.
  4. Withdraw cash from ATMs: In some cases, you may be able to withdraw cash directly from your HSA account using ATMs. Be aware of any associated fees or restrictions.

Remember, it's crucial to only use your HSA funds for eligible medical expenses to avoid penalties. Consult with your HSA provider or financial advisor for specific guidelines on withdrawing money from your HSA card.
